Advanced Tips for Optimal PDF Compression

While iLovePDF compress is incredibly user-friendly out of the box, there are a few neat tricks you can employ to get even better results, especially if you're dealing with particularly stubborn or complex PDFs. First off, understand your needs. Are you sending a document with lots of high-resolution images, or is it mostly text? If it’s image-heavy, the images are likely the biggest culprits for file size. iLovePDF does a fantastic job of optimizing these images, but if you have control over the source files before creating the PDF, consider downsampling your images to a reasonable resolution (like 150-300 DPI for print, or even less for web-only use) and compressing them before insertion. This is a more advanced workflow, but it can yield significant savings. Secondly, experiment with the compression levels. As mentioned, iLovePDF offers different options. Don't just stick to the default. If 'Recommended' gives you a file size that's still a tad too big, try 'Extreme'. Conversely, if 'Extreme' makes the quality a little too noticeable, perhaps the 'Recommended' setting is actually perfect, or maybe you need to tweak something else. Another tip is to check the PDF properties before and after compression. Sometimes, PDFs contain embedded fonts or metadata that aren't strictly necessary and can add bloat. While iLovePDF handles much of this automatically, understanding these elements can help you appreciate why certain files compress better than others. For documents with scanned pages, ensure the OCR (Optical Character Recognition) process has been completed effectively if you plan to make the text searchable. A well-executed OCR can sometimes help in compressing the underlying image data more efficiently. Lastly, remember that quality vs. size is a trade-off. It’s rare to achieve massive compression without any impact on quality. The key is to find the sweet spot where the file size is significantly reduced while the visual fidelity remains perfectly acceptable for your intended purpose. iLovePDF makes this balancing act remarkably easy, but being aware of these factors will help you leverage its power even more effectively. The Security and Convenience of Online PDF Compression

One of the biggest concerns people have when using online tools, and rightly so, is security. We often upload sensitive or confidential documents, and the last thing we want is for that information to fall into the wrong hands. This is where platforms like iLovePDF compress really shine. They understand the importance of privacy and security. Reputable services like iLovePDF typically employ robust security measures. This often includes using SSL encryption for all file transfers, meaning your documents are protected while they’re being uploaded to their servers and when the compressed file is downloaded back to you. Furthermore, most services, including iLovePDF, have clear policies about how long they retain your files. Usually, files are automatically deleted from their servers after a short period (often just a few hours) once you've finished your session. This ensures your data isn't lingering unnecessarily.
